Jack Gibson (ice hockey, born 1948)

Jack Gibson (born August 18, 1948) is a Canadian former professional ice hockey left winger.

Early life

Gibson was born in Picton, Ontario. He played junior hockey with the Moose Jaw Canucks and was a member of the Alberta Golden Bears at the University of Alberta.

Career

Gibson played 122 games in the World Hockey Association. He was a member of the Ottawa Nationals and Toronto Toros.
